MYSQL数据怎么从一个电脑转移到另一个的电脑

上周,我那个朋友遇到了数据库迁移的问题。
他首先找到my.ini文件,里面有一行datadir=...,这行指示了数据库文件的目录。
他关掉了mysql服务,然后把整个目录拷贝到了新环境,重新配置了my.ini,让目录吻合。
这步操作花了大概2 0分钟。

然后,他备份了数据库。
他用PHPMYADMIN这个工具导出了数据库,或者也可以通过命令行,使用“mysqldump-u用户名-pdatabasename>exportfilename”这样的命令来导出数据库到文件。
备份这一步大概用了1 0分钟。

之后,他在新的数据库服务器上还原数据。
首先,他进入了MySQL命令行客户端,输入密码后进入了“mysql>”状态。
然后,他使用“showdatabases;”命令查看有哪些数据库。
接着,他创建了一个新的数据库,输入“createdatabasevoice;”命令。
切换到新数据库后,使用“usevoice;”命令,然后导入数据,输入“sourcevoice.sql;”命令,开始导入数据。
当再次出现“mysql>”并且没有错误提示时,就意味着还原成功了。
这个过程大概花了3 0分钟。

对了,他还提到,导入数据时,如果遇到错误,可以检查SQL文件的格式,或者检查是否有权限等问题。
这个过程有时候会遇到一些小问题,但总体来说,按照这些步骤操作,数据库迁移还是比较顺利的。
算了,你看着办吧,这些步骤应该对你也适用。

mysql数据库迁移详细步骤

步骤1 :备份源库,用mysqldump,比如:mysqldump -u用户 -p密码 数据库名 > backup.sql 步骤2 :目标库配置,装MySQL,创建库,检查资源,调配置。
步骤3 :转架构,用mysqldump导架构,导入目标库,验架构。
步骤4 :转数据,导数据文件,导入目标库,验数据。
步骤5 :用户权限,创建用户,授予权限,刷新权限。
步骤6 :测试迁移,写测试查,跑查,比结果。
步骤7 :迁移,改连接,跑应用,看日志。
步骤8 :清理监控,删备份,调配置,监控稳定。

通过data文件夹迁移mysql数据

哎呦,迁移MySQL数据这事儿,其实就挺简单的,我给你说说啊,得,先来个MySQL安装,咱们就以Windows1 0下的MySQL5 .7 压缩版为例,先下载一个mysql-5 .7 .3 3 -winx6 4 的压缩包,找个大点的磁盘,比如D盘,给它解压了。
然后,你得把MySQL的bin目录路径加到系统环境变量里,这样用起来方便。

接下来,初始化和安装服务,打开终端,输入mysqld--initialize--console,这会生成个初始密码,记得保存啊。
然后,再输入mysqld--installmysql,安装MySQL服务,再输入netstartmysql,启动MySQL服务,这事儿就搞定了。

下一步,配置my.ini文件,得先把MySQL服务停掉,然后用文本文档新建个my.ini文件,配置一下参数,这些参数你可以在百度上找找,有很多配置示例的。

然后,咱们来迁移data文件夹的内容,先确定迁移哪些文件,就是旧的data文件夹里的数据存储库文件夹和ibdata1 文件,其他的就别动。
如果新的data文件夹里头有重复的文件和文件夹,比如ibdata1 和mysql,你就直接覆盖了事。

弄完了,重启MySQL服务,如果启动成功了,那恭喜你,数据迁移就算完成了。
要是启动不成功,你先查查服务状态,执行个scquerymysql看看。
要是服务不存在,你得先删了它,执行个scdeletemysql。
然后,删掉MySQL安装目录下data文件夹里的相关文件,这些文件后面操作会重新生成的。

重新安装和启动服务,再执行mysqld--installmysql,然后再来个netstartmysql。
要是MySQL服务禁用了,你得重启电脑,再执行那些命令。

就这样了,希望这能帮到你。
哎,迁移数据这事儿,有时候还真是挺头疼的。